Information for clients of the Vaivari Technical Aids Centre.
If you use an assistive device that needs to be connected to electricity at all times, such as:
- a positive pressure breathing device,
- an oxygen concentrator,
and there is a power outage, and you find yourself in a life-threatening situation, you must immediately call the Emergency Medical Service at 113.
The Ministry of Climate and Energy provides guidelines on how to prepare for potential issues with the electricity network.
